DEC Pathworks hints

Question: What hints might I find regarding Pathworks 4.1, 5.0 and performance issues with the 3C509?

Answer: [Taken from CompuServe]:

"The /n switch stop the "sch" from sending a sort of answerback message on the network, which is what the Depca cards do to make sure they're alive. You should also put a "/fc:1" on the DNP line in PW4.1 and a "/fc:1 /sdb:10" in cfgxxxxx.tpl on the "DNP" line for PW5. The "FC" is for flow control and "SDB" is for small data blocks.
